Ever since the yellow "Livestrong" wristbands caught on and became almost ubiquitous, people have realized the potential of using silicone wristbands to raise funds, show support for a cause, or promote awareness of an issue. Silicone wristbands are cheap to make and can be embossed with any slogan or name. They come in a nearly endless variety of colors to represent any group or cause. Symbols of solidarity and empathy in the face of adversity. That is what the ubiquitous yellow rubber bracelets of Lance Armstrong's Live Strong Foundation are. But when the ace cyclist who overcame cancer to win the Tour de France seven times in a row promoted his signature yellow rubber wristbands, little did he know that he was kicking off a global trend. Today rubber bracelets are no longer just about cancer; they have become the ultimate fundraising tool for charities.
